infrangible

Unbreakable, indestructible, or very difficult to break.

Pronounced as (IPA)
/ɪnˈfɹænd͡ʒɪbəl/
Etymology

From Middle French infrangible, from Old French infrangible, from Medieval Latin in- (“not”) + frangibilis, from Latin frangō (“to break”).
